About AMP Robotics

AMP Robotics is a company that develops AI powered robotic systems for automated recycling and material recovery, using computer vision and machine learning to sort recyclable materials on production lines.

Trend Decomposition

Trend Decomposition

Trigger: Introduction of AI enabled robotics to automate complex sorting tasks in recycling facilities, driven by the need to increase throughput and accuracy.

Behavior change: Recycling facilities increasingly adopt autonomous sorting robots and integrated AI software to handle diverse stream compositions with higher precision.

Enabler: Advances in AI perception, robotic manipulation, and on site edge computing reduce need for human labor and speed up material recovery.

Constraint removed: Labor intensive manual sorting and inconsistent material streams are mitigated by automated, scalable robotic sortation.

Jobs to be done framework

Jobs to be done framework

What problem does this trend help solve?

Automates high variability sorting tasks to increase throughput and material purity.

What workaround existed before?

Manual human sorting and semi automated conveyors with limited accuracy.

What outcome matters most?

Speed and accuracy of sorting, driving higher material recovery and lower contamination.
